Transaction 950ea66580e8661d462e57131f098bb1712ab26fe4574b817a0145be26ff5765
1 Input
2 Outputs
- 950ea66580e8661d462e57131f098bb1712ab26fe4574b817a0145be26ff5765:0
- 950ea66580e8661d462e57131f098bb1712ab26fe4574b817a0145be26ff5765:1
value 4200648
address 34PtmJS62VBHhgUx9jHxdfZpmwiuZDLqTf
value 187862840
address 1gJai5xfQHVvnpAR6dtyDwzvDVMvgYcxt